About
Originally setting out by singing in church from the age of five, before kick-starting her jazz career at 18 and never looking back, Emma has tried her voice at multiple musical genres from gospel to a capella styles, funk, soul and jazz. A varied career included coaching vocals for theatre productions and workshops, even providing a soundtrack for the Rutger Hauer movie 'Tempesta'.
In more recent years, she has been developing her vocal talents in combination with those of fellow jazz, funk and soul musicians Anders Olinder, Andy Tween and Kit Morgan to form the current four-piece wedding and function group Soul D Light. She is now continuing her performing career, presenting upbeat live music for weddings, a trade she has been perfecting for over ten years.
